input::-webkit-input-placeholder { 
-webkit-transition: all .5s; 
}
/* 关于易丰 */
.service{width: 100%;}
.service_a{width:1300px;margin:0 auto;text-align: center;padding:50px 0;}
.service_a h4{font-size:32px;font-weight:400;line-height:32px;}
.service_a h4 span{width:60px;height:1px;background:#E0E0E0;display:inline-block;margin-bottom:12px;}
.service_a h4 span:first-child{margin-right:40px;}
.service_a h4 span:last-child{margin-left:40px;}
.service_b{width:100%;height:14px;margin-top:18px;font-size: 14px;color:#999;text-align:center;}

#advantage{position:relative;background:#F5F5F5;}
#advantage .porject{width:100%;height:100%;transition:all 1s ease;}

.advantage{width:100%;}
.advantage .advantage_a{width:1300px;margin:0 auto;}
.advantage .advantage_a .layui-tab{border:0;margin:0;width:100%;}
.advantage .advantage_a .adv{width:100%;display:flex;text-align: center;}
.advantage .layui-tab .layui-tab-title{border:0;margin:0 auto;}
.advantage .layui-tab .layui-tab-title li{width:120px;height:38px;margin-right:20px;background:#E1E1E1;color:#333;padding:0;border-radius:5px;}
.advantage .layui-tab .layui-tab-title li:last-child{margin-right:0;}
.advantage .layui-tab .layui-tab-title li:hover{background:#512b82;color:#fff;}
.layui-tab-title .layui-this{background:#512b82 !important;color:#fff !important;}
.layui-tab-title .layui-this:after{border:0;height:0;}
.advantage .layui-tab-content{width:100%;padding:70px 0;height:500px}
.advantage .layui-tab-content .layui-tab-item{width:100%;}
.advantage .layui-tab-content .layui-tab-item .adv_left{float:left;width:600px;}
.advantage .layui-tab-content .layui-tab-item .adv_right{float:right;width:700px;height:340px;margin-top:10px;background: #fff;padding:60px;}
.advantage .layui-tab-content .layui-tab-item .adv_right h2 span{display:inline-block;height:43px;border-bottom:2px solid #414141;width:190px;text-align:left;color:#333;font-size: 20px;}
.advantage .layui-tab-content .layui-tab-item .adv_right p{color:#888;line-height:2;font-size: 16px;margin-top:30px;}
#banner_ff{overflow:hidden;position:relative;background:#f5f5f5;padding-bottom:70px;}
zx-process-box {margin-top: 52px}
.index-zzx-step {margin-top: 16px;font-size: 18px;color: #666}
.index-zzx-detail {margin-top: 3px;font-size: 15px;color: #999}
.zzx-step-box {margin-top: 28px;height: 33px}
.zzx-step-img {position: relative;float: left;margin-left: 5px}
.zzx-step-img-first {margin-left: 25px}
.icon-round{float:left;width:33px;height:33px;background:#fff;border:1px solid #e5e5e5;border-radius:100%;}
/* .zzx-step-img:hover .icon-round{background:#512b82;border:0;}
.zzx-step-img:hover .step-num{color:#fff;} */
.step-num{position: absolute;top:7px;left:13px;font-size:14px;color: #a3a3a3}
.index-yzs .yzs-bg-left,.index-yzs .yzs-bg-right,.yzs-bg-right-box {top: 0;position: absolute;height: 500px}
.step-line {float: left;width: 188px;height: 1px;margin: 16px 0 0 5px;background-color: #e3e3e3;}
.index-yzs {position: relative;height: 500px;overflow: hidden;-webkit-transform: translate(0, 10%);-moz-transform: translate(0, 10%);-ms-transform: translate(0, 10%);-o-transform: translate(0, 10%);transform: translate(0, 10%);}
.index-yzs .yzs-bg-left img {width: 1536px;height: 1000px;margin-top: -300px;margin-left: -371px}
.index-yzs-bg {float: left;width: 100%}
.index-yzs .yzs-bg-left {left: 0;*width: 65%;overflow: hidden;}
.yzs-bg-right-box {right: 0;z-index: 11;width: 597px;*width: 45%;}
.zzx-process-box li:hover .index-zzx-step{color:#FF5A02;}
.zzx_process{height:80px;width:81px;display:inline-block;overflow:hidden;transition:0.35s all;}
.zzx_process img:first-child{transform:translateY(0px);transition:0.35s all;}
.zzx_process img:last-child{transform:translateY(10px);transition:0.35s all;}
.zzx-process-box li:hover .zzx_process img:first-child{transform:translateY(-80px);transition:0.35s all;}
.zzx-process-box li:hover .zzx_process  img:last-child{transform:translateY(-80px);transition:0.35s all;}
.zzx-process-yy {width: 142px;}
.zzx-process-lf {width: 152px;}
.zzx-process-fa {width: 144px;}
.zzx-process-ht {width: 155px;}
.zzx-process-sg {width: 145px;}
.zzx-process-ys {width: 150px;}
.zzx-process-bz {width: 112px;}
.zzx-process-box ul {overflow: hidden;}
.zzx-process-box ul li {position: relative;float: left;text-align:center;}
.zzx-process-box ul li p {white-space: nowrap;}
.zzx-process-box ul li span {display: block;}
.zzx-process-box ul li+li {margin-left:80px;}

/* 地址 */
#transport{height:100%;width:100%;overflow:hidden;position:relative;background:#fff;padding-bottom:100px;}
#transport #transport .transport{height:100%;width:100%;transition:all 1s ease;}
#transport .transport_a{height:100%;width:1300px;margin:0 auto;}
#transport .transport_a ul{width:1300px;height:496px;}
#transport .transport_a li{margin-bottom: 20px !important;float:left;width:310px;height:280px;margin-right:20px;border-radius:4px;border:1px solid #ECECEC;box-shadow:2px 2px 3px #ececec;transition:all 0.3s ease;}
#transport .transport_a li .img_box img{height:220px;width:308px;transform: scale(1.05);}
#transport .transport_a li:nth-child(4n){margin-right: 0 !important;}
#transport .transport_a li:hover img{transform: scale(1);cursor: pointer;transition: all 1s ease; }
#transport .transport_a li:hover{box-shadow:2px 2px 10px #C8C8C8;transform:translateY(-10px);}
#transport .img_box{width:308px;height:220px;overflow:hidden;background:#fff;}
#transport .transport_a h3{font-size: 18px;font-weight: normal;margin: 16px 0 0 12px;text-align:center;}

/* 新闻详情 */
#chess .chess{width: 100%;height:100%;background:#fff;position: relative;}
#chess .chess_a{width: 1300px;height:100%;margin: 0 auto;}
#chess .service_n{width: 100%;height: 142px;}			
#chess .swiper-p{width: 378px;float: right;}
#chess .swiper-p p{font-size: 14px;line-height: 26px;color: #7a7a7a;}
.diepic{height:440px;width:100%;}
.diepic ul{width:100%;padding:0 18px;}
.diepic ul li{width:625px;height:132px;border:1px solid #EAEAEA;margin-bottom:18px;padding:30px 20px;box-shadow:2px 2px 3px #ececec;border-radius:5px;transition: all 1s ;}
.diepic ul li:nth-child(2n-1){float:left;}
.diepic ul li:nth-child(2n){float:right;}
.diepic ul li h2{font-size:17px;font-weight:600;color:#333;line-height:17px;margin-bottom:15px;}
.diepic ul li p{font-size:14px;color:#999;line-height:2;}
#chess .more{width:100%;text-align:center;padding:58px 0 70px;margin:0 auto;height:182px;}
#chess .more button{height:42px;border:1px solid #e5e5e5;color:#512b82;width:180px;background:0;}
.diepic ul li:hover{transform:translateY(-10px);}






